Follow this Final Fantasy VI walkthrough to find Shadow in the Cave on the Veldt. Learn about the enemies, items, and boss fights on your way to recruiting him.

Walkthrough
  1. 1
    Enter the Cave on the Veldt. If Interceptor is present, Shadow might be here. Follow him north and exit east.
  2. 2
    In the next area, go east, then northwest to find the Berserker Ring. Proceed through the door.
  3. 3
    Go down the stairs, then west through the cavern tunnel. Head to the far west, go east twice, south, and west to find a chest. Defeat the Death Warden (HP: 8000) inside to obtain the Tigerfang for Sabin.
  4. 4
    Return to the tunnel, take the southern branch, and follow the linear path. You will find a room with a chest and a switch. Open the chest to get the Ichigeki. Keep this item.
  5. 5
    Flip the switch to open a new path. Follow it north to a Save Point.
  6. 6
    Return to the door and continue to find Shadow injured. He will be attacked by the Behemoth Kings.
  7. 7
    Defeat the first Behemoth King (uses Blizzara, Blizzaga, Meteor, Devil Claw). Use elemental attacks and healing.
  8. 8
    Defeat the second Behemoth King (uses Death, Hypno Gas, Meteor). A Phoenix Down is effective.
  9. 9
    After the scene, you will be in Thamasa. Leave Thamasa and go to the Coliseum to the southeast.
  10. 10
    Speak to the man in front of the Coliseum door and bet the Ichigeki.
  11. 11
    Battle Shadow. After the fight, Shadow will join your party.
Tips
  • The Death Warden uses Death-based attacks; equip Death-proof gear or be prepared to heal.
  • The Ichigeki is crucial for recruiting Shadow, so do not lose it.
  • For the first Behemoth King, use elemental magic like Fira/Firaga and healing spells. Espers like Kirin, Ifrit, and Fenrir can help with damage and defense.
  • The second Behemoth King can be defeated quickly with a Phoenix Down.
  • Use Phantom Rush and your strongest attacks against the first Behemoth King.
  • Shadow joins your party.
